"Berytus" meaning in Latin

See Berytus in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Proper name

IPA: /beːˈryː.tus/ [Classical], [beːˈryːt̪ʊs̠] [Classical], /beˈri.tus/ (note: modern Italianate Ecclesiastical), [beˈriːt̪us] (note: modern Italianate Ecclesiastical)
Etymology: From Ancient Greek Βηρυτός (Bērutós), from Phoenician 𐤁𐤓𐤕 (brt).   1. Berytus (today known as Beirut) Tags: declension-2 Categories (place): Capital cities Synonyms: Bērȳtos Derived forms: bērȳtensis, bērȳtius
